Regional Autonomous Corporation of La Guajira, Corpoguajira, continues to implement actions to mitigate the adverse effects of climate change in the region, jointly with the Association of Professionals and Environmentalists of La Guajira, "Asopaguja". In this regard, The construction of a suitable structure for the production of organic fertilizer is underway through known techniques for obtaining compost., a natural product resulting from the decomposition of materials of plant or animal origin that has the ability to improve soil fertility and at the same time nourish plants.
It should be noted that the installation of 4 structures throughout the area of influence of the project, (Riohacha, India, Manaure and Dibulla) , where they will benefit around 300 families settled in the lower basins of the Tapias and DMI Rio Ranchería rivers. As a result of this initiative, It is intended that the production of fertilizer be for community use and allow families, integrate, share and put into practice principles such as solidarity, community participation and associativity, with the other members of the region.
Ecological benefits of organic fertilizers:
- They fertilize the soil
- They maintain and create microbial life on earth.
- If the land is hard it makes it softer.
- If the land is sandy it makes it firmer.
- They help retain rainwater.
- They give more types of nutrients and the roots can take them
- They increase the thickness of the stems and size of the fruits.
- They affirm the colors of stems, leaves and fruits.
- Crops increase.
- Nutrients remain for 2 ó 3 years on the plot.
- They increase and affirm the flavor and smell of the fruits.
- They increase the quantity and quality of proteins in the fruits.
